What is there to see and do in Dalmally?
Spend some time experiencing the great outdoors at Loch Awe and Loch Lomond and The Trossachs National Park. Discover sights such as Kilchurn Castle, St Conan's Kirk and Cruachan Power Station during your stay.
When is the best time to book a hotel with a pool in Dalmally?
Taking the local weather in Dalmally into account is an important factor for planning your visit, especially if you plan to spend your trip by the pool.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 12°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 2°C. The rainiest months in Dalmally are October, December, November and January, with each month seeing an average of 216 mm of rainfall.
What's the best way to travel around Dalmally?
Knowing the transportation options in and around Dalmally can help you enjoy the area beyond your hotel pool. If you'd like to explore more of the area, take a train from Dalmally Station, Loch Awe Station or Falls of Cruachan Station. Dalmally may not have many public transport choices, so consider renting a car to explore more.
